ADDITIONAL FEATURES Marking all messages as read: 1) While viewing the Inbox on the AUX-TEXT MESSAGING Page, press the MENU Key to display the Page Menu. 2) Turn either FMS Knob to place the cursor on 'Mark All New Messages As Read'. 3) Press the ENT Key. A confirmation window is displayed. 4) With cursor highlighting 'YES', press the ENT Key. The message symbols now indicate all the message have been opened. Delete a message: 1) While viewing the Inbox on the AUX-TEXT MESSAGING Page, press the FMS Knob to activate the cursor. 2) Turn either FMS Knob to select the desired message. 3) Select the DELETE Softkey. Or: a) Press the MENU Key to display the Page Menu. b) Turn either FMS Knob to place the cursor on 'Delete Selected Message'. c) Press the ENT Key. WI-FI CONNECTIONS The system can connect to a IEEE 802.11g compatible network provided the aircraft is on the ground and located within range of the network. The system is capable of WEP64, WEP128,WPA-PSK, and WPA2-PSK encryption formats. WPA-Enterprise and WPA2-Enterprise are not supported. Connections that require web proxies, captive portals, or other elements that require user credentials, including a username and password or a redemption or access code; or require action such as accepting a user agreement, are not supported. Control and monitoring of Wi-Fi functions are accomplished through the AUX-WI-FI SETUP Page.
